Job Purpose:
To improve outcomes, transform lives, and enable social mobility by delivering an efficient and professional HR and Payroll service to all academies.
The Payroll officer will embody and promote the organisation's values while supporting the Director of HR in providing high quality transactional HR services and overseeing the outsourced payroll function.
Initially working independently, the post holder will manage all day-to-day transactional HR and payroll activity, with a future opportunity to lead a small team as the service expands. This role combines operational delivery with process development and continuous improvement.
Key Accountabilities
To take accountability for the management of dedicated People casework, ensuring legislation, policy and best practice are followed, and options and risks are clearly explored and analysed
